Latest Patents
Jianqing holds a patent titled "Unified Pipeline for Media Metadata Convergence." This innovation enables computing devices to provide a unified pipeline that converges disparate metadata schemas and structures into a comprehensive global unified graph. The approach allows for the receipt of media metadata from various sources, which may each utilize different schemas that define their metadata. By comparing and analyzing this data, Jianqing's method determines corresponding media entities, such as songs, movies, or books, and integrates their attributes into a singular, cohesive graph.
